STACKED FRUIT Recipe

Ingredients:

1 (29-oz.) can sliced peaches, drained
1 (29 oz.) can pears, drained
1 (20 oz.) can pineapple chunks, drained
2 (10-oz.) package frozen strawberries
2 (3¾ oz.) boxes instant vanilla pudding
3 large bananas

Directions:

In a large bowl, stack peaches, pears, and pineapple in order given. Top with undrained thawed strawberries. On fruit sprinkle dry pudding; do not stir. Cover; refrigerate overnight. An hour or so before serving. Stir well and return to refrigerator. Just before serving, add bananas. Serves 16-20.
